Damiend99b0522013-12-21 18:17:45 +00001#include <stdlib.h>
2#include <stdint.h>
3#include <stdarg.h>
4#include <string.h>
5#include <assert.h>
6
7#include "nlr.h"
8#include "misc.h"
9#include "mpconfig.h"
10#include "obj.h"
11#include "runtime0.h"
12#include "runtime.h"
13
14typedef struct _mp_obj_str_t {
15 mp_obj_base_t base;
16 qstr qstr;
17} mp_obj_str_t;
18
19void str_print(void (*print)(void *env, const char *fmt, ...), void *env, mp_obj_t self_in) {
20 mp_obj_str_t *self = self_in;
21 // TODO need to escape chars etc
22 print(env, "'%s'", qstr_str(self->qstr));
23}
24
25mp_obj_t str_binary_op(int op, mp_obj_t lhs_in, mp_obj_t rhs_in) {
26 mp_obj_str_t *lhs = lhs_in;
27 const char *lhs_str = qstr_str(lhs->qstr);
28 switch (op) {
29 case RT_BINARY_OP_SUBSCR:
30 // string access
31 // XXX a massive hack!
32 return mp_obj_new_int(lhs_str[mp_obj_get_int(rhs_in)]);
33
34 case RT_BINARY_OP_ADD:
35 case RT_BINARY_OP_INPLACE_ADD:
36 if (MP_OBJ_IS_TYPE(rhs_in, &str_type)) {
37 // add 2 strings
38 const char *rhs_str = qstr_str(((mp_obj_str_t*)rhs_in)->qstr);
39 char *val = m_new(char, strlen(lhs_str) + strlen(rhs_str) + 1);
40 stpcpy(stpcpy(val, lhs_str), rhs_str);
41 return mp_obj_new_str(qstr_from_str_take(val));
42 }
43 break;
44 }
45
46 return MP_OBJ_NULL; // op not supported
47}
48
49mp_obj_t str_join(mp_obj_t self_in, mp_obj_t arg) {
50 assert(MP_OBJ_IS_TYPE(self_in, &str_type));
51 mp_obj_str_t *self = self_in;
52 int required_len = strlen(qstr_str(self->qstr));
53
54 // process arg, count required chars
55 uint seq_len;
56 mp_obj_t *seq_items;
57 if (MP_OBJ_IS_TYPE(arg, &tuple_type)) {
58 mp_obj_tuple_get(arg, &seq_len, &seq_items);
59 } else if (MP_OBJ_IS_TYPE(arg, &list_type)) {
60 mp_obj_list_get(arg, &seq_len, &seq_items);
61 } else {
62 goto bad_arg;
63 }
64 for (int i = 0; i < seq_len; i++) {
65 if (!MP_OBJ_IS_TYPE(seq_items[i], &str_type)) {
66 goto bad_arg;
67 }
68 required_len += strlen(qstr_str(mp_obj_str_get(seq_items[i])));
69 }
70
71 // make joined string
72 char *joined_str = m_new(char, required_len + 1);
73 joined_str[0] = 0;
74 for (int i = 0; i < seq_len; i++) {
75 const char *s2 = qstr_str(mp_obj_str_get(seq_items[i]));
76 if (i > 0) {
77 strcat(joined_str, qstr_str(self->qstr));
78 }
79 strcat(joined_str, s2);
80 }
81 return mp_obj_new_str(qstr_from_str_take(joined_str));
82
83bad_arg:
84 nlr_jump(mp_obj_new_exception_msg(rt_q_TypeError, "?str.join expecting a list of str's"));
85}
86
87void vstr_printf_wrapper(void *env, const char *fmt, ...) {
88 va_list args;
89 va_start(args, fmt);
90 vstr_vprintf(env, fmt, args);
91 va_end(args);
92}
93
94mp_obj_t str_format(int n_args, const mp_obj_t *args) {
95 assert(MP_OBJ_IS_TYPE(args[0], &str_type));
96 mp_obj_str_t *self = args[0];
97
98 const char *str = qstr_str(self->qstr);
99 int arg_i = 1;
100 vstr_t *vstr = vstr_new();
101 for (; *str; str++) {
102 if (*str == '{') {
103 str++;
104 if (*str == '{') {
105 vstr_add_char(vstr, '{');
106 } else if (*str == '}') {
107 if (arg_i >= n_args) {
108 nlr_jump(mp_obj_new_exception_msg(rt_q_IndexError, "tuple index out of range"));
109 }
110 mp_obj_print_helper(vstr_printf_wrapper, vstr, args[arg_i]);
111 arg_i++;
112 }
113 } else {
114 vstr_add_char(vstr, *str);
115 }
116 }
117
118 return mp_obj_new_str(qstr_from_str_take(vstr->buf));
119}
120
121static MP_DEFINE_CONST_FUN_OBJ_2(str_join_obj, str_join);
122static MP_DEFINE_CONST_FUN_OBJ_VAR(str_format_obj, 1, str_format);
123
124const mp_obj_type_t str_type = {
125 { &mp_const_type },
126 "str",
127 str_print, // print
128 NULL, // call_n
129 NULL, // unary_op
130 str_binary_op, // binary_op
131 NULL, // getiter
132 NULL, // iternext
133 { // method list
134 { "join", &str_join_obj },
135 { "format", &str_format_obj },
136 { NULL, NULL }, // end-of-list sentinel
137 },
138};
139
140mp_obj_t mp_obj_new_str(qstr qstr) {
141 mp_obj_str_t *o = m_new_obj(mp_obj_str_t);
142 o->base.type = &str_type;
143 o->qstr = qstr;
144 return o;
145}
146
147qstr mp_obj_str_get(mp_obj_t self_in) {
148 assert(MP_OBJ_IS_TYPE(self_in, &str_type));
149 mp_obj_str_t *self = self_in;
150 return self->qstr;
151}
